The
Community Support Services Program
provides the necessary supports and services to individuals
with developmental disabilities, to achieve successful community
living. Individuals may live alone, with friends, with family,
in Family Care Homes, or in Individual Residential Alternatives.
What
does Community Support Services Offer?
- Service
Coordination to assist with arranging any and all
supports including medical, residential, SSI and other
benefits, vocational, clinical, programmatic, and advocacy
in accessing community resources.
- Residential
Habilitation Homecare to assist individuals in achieving
or maintaining independent living. Assist in acquisition
of daily living skills including money management, cooking,
meal planning, shopping, appointments, and home maintenance.
- Recreation
provides socialization and organized activities for children
and adults.
- Family
Reimbursement for services and goods required to care
for a developmentally disabled family member.
- Transportation
is provided for medical appointments, dental appointments,
and any other needs as requested.
- In
Home Respite/Sitter Services
- Family/Individual
Choice
Who
Can Receive Services?
Any individual who has a developmental disability, any family
who is caring for a family member with a developmental disability.
